Yesterday at San Diego Comic-Con, four developers from Telltale and Hothead presented a question-and-answer panel on episodic gaming and the rebirth of the adventure game genre -- true adventure games, that is, the ones where you able through a low-stress environment and use various found objects to interact with characters and their surroundings. Representing Telltale, best-known for the Sam & Max series, were Dave Grossman and Dan Connor. Arthur We and Joel DeYoung sat in for Hothead (Penny Arcade Adventures: On the Rain-Slick Precipice of Doom), and GameTap's Frank Cifaldi -- responsible for the upcoming American McGee's Grimm -- moderated.
